How to Clean Evening Dresses at Home?
Evening dresses are usually made from delicate fabrics and can be easily damaged by incorrect cleaning methods. The first thing to pay attention to when cleaning evening wear at home is to follow the care instructions specified on the label. Generally, these types of dresses are recommended to be hand washed or dry cleaned. If hand washing is recommended for the dress, you can clean it using cold water and a gentle detergent. Avoid pulling the fabric or using stiff brushes. At what temperature should a formal dress be washed?
The washing temperature of evening dresses is quite important. Most evening dresses should be washed with cold water. Hot water can damage the fabric's texture, lead to color fading, and cause seams to open. Generally, a temperature between 30°C - 40°C is an ideal temperature range for evening dresses. How to Clean Evening Dresses That Cannot Be Washed in the Washing Machine?
Some evening dresses elbise should not be thrown into the washing machine because the fabric structures may get damaged or lose their shape when taken out of the machine. The safest cleaning method for such garments is dry cleaning. Dry cleaning provides professional cleaning without harming your clothes. If you want to perform dry cleaning at home, you can use a special dry cleaning spray. You can gently apply this spray on the stains on the garment and wipe it with a clean cloth. However, this process does not always replace professional dry cleaning, so it is beneficial to consult experts from time to time. How to Iron a Evening Dress?
Ironing evening dresses is extremely easy when the right techniques are used. However, incorrect ironing can damage the fabric of your dress and lead to distortion of its shape. When ironing the evening dress, be careful to work at a low temperature. Also, avoid ironing directly on the fabric. At this point, you may prefer to use a fabric cover while ironing. Additionally, in some evening dresses, using steam can be quite effective in removing wrinkles. This way, wrinkles can be eliminated without damaging the fabric.
How to Store Evening Dresses?
To properly preserve your evening dresses for a long time, it is essential to pay attention to the right storage methods. When hanging the dress on a hanger, prefer wide-shouldered hangers. This helps maintain the shape of the dress and prevents deformation in the shoulder area. Additionally, you should store your dress in a dark and cool room, keeping it away from direct sunlight. You can use special protective fabric bags to protect your evening dresses. These bags prevent dust and dirt from accumulating on the dress while allowing the fabric to breathe.
